WebMar 1, 2024 · H. pylori is a spiral-shaped germ (bacteria) that infects the stomach. It can damage the tissue in your child’s stomach and the first part of the small intestine (duodenum). This can cause redness and swelling (inflammation). It may also cause painful sores called peptic ulcers in the upper digestive tract. Webhas demonstrated a lack of evidence of child-to-child H. pylori transmission outside the family. To explain this, their group supports the alternative hypothesis that mother-child transmission is an important mechanism for the spread of H. pylori.
